What action did the United States take that the Queen believes is an injustice?

English
1 answer:
valina [46]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Explanation: On January 17, in the year 1893, the Kingdom of Hawaiʻi was illegally overthrown. ... 12, 1898, Hawaiʻi became a Territory of the United States by annexation, at a formal noontime ceremony held in front of ʻIolani Palace. My mother and father and most Hawaiians stayed away from that heart-breaking ceremony

The central idea of a text is the author's aim to convey a message within its lines, and it always consists of the theme being discussed. Although often the author might not indicate the central idea explicitly, it can be carried out with clarity as the text goes on.

A theme is a very specific element taken from a subject, whereas a topic is a generalization of this subject. For example:


Topic: Books.

Theme: The Role of Books in a Student's Learning Process.
